Heritage Museum
Turn right (south on Harrison Avenue) and begin
your tour down Leadvilles main street walking on the south
side of the street in front of the Healy House.
The brick building at the northeast corner of Harrison
and 9th is the Heritage Museum.
Built as the Carnegie Library, it opened in 1904, two years after
the cornerstone date of 1902. It served as the library for the
area until 1971 when it was turned into a local museum. It is
open during the summer months and houses a scale model of the
Leadville Ice Palace, an excellent display of 10th Mountain Division
memorabilia and various Leadville artifacts.
